Copyright | (c) Sven Panne 2014 |
---|---|
License | BSD3 |
Maintainer | Sven Panne <[email protected]> |
Stability | stable |
Portability | portable |
Safe Haskell | None |
Language | Haskell2010 |
Graphics.Rendering.OpenGL.Raw.ARB.SamplerObjects
Description
All raw functions and tokens from the ARB_sampler_objects extension, see http://www.opengl.org/registry/specs/ARB/sampler_objects.txt.
- glGenSamplers :: GLsizei -> Ptr GLuint -> IO ()
- glDeleteSamplers :: GLsizei -> Ptr GLuint -> IO ()
- glIsSampler :: GLuint -> IO GLboolean
- glBindSampler :: GLuint -> GLuint -> IO ()
- glSamplerParameteri :: GLuint -> GLenum -> GLint -> IO ()
- glSamplerParameteriv :: GLuint -> GLenum -> Ptr GLint -> IO ()
- glSamplerParameterf :: GLuint -> GLenum -> GLfloat -> IO ()
- glSamplerParameterfv :: GLuint -> GLenum -> Ptr GLfloat -> IO ()
- glSamplerParameterIiv :: GLuint -> GLenum -> Ptr GLint -> IO ()
- glSamplerParameterIuiv :: GLuint -> GLenum -> Ptr GLuint -> IO ()
- glGetSamplerParameteriv :: GLuint -> GLenum -> Ptr GLint -> IO ()
- glGetSamplerParameterIiv :: GLuint -> GLenum -> Ptr GLint -> IO ()
- glGetSamplerParameterfv :: GLuint -> GLenum -> Ptr GLfloat -> IO ()
- glGetSamplerParameterIuiv :: GLuint -> GLenum -> Ptr GLuint -> IO ()
- gl_SAMPLER_BINDING :: GLenum
Functions
Manual pages for OpenGL 3.x or OpenGL 4.x
Manual pages for OpenGL 3.x or OpenGL 4.x
Manual pages for OpenGL 3.x or OpenGL 4.x
Manual pages for OpenGL 3.x or OpenGL 4.x
Manual pages for OpenGL 3.x or OpenGL 4.x
Arguments
:: GLuint |
|
-> GLenum |
|
-> Ptr GLint |
|
-> IO () |
Manual pages for OpenGL 3.x or OpenGL 4.x
Manual pages for OpenGL 3.x or OpenGL 4.x
Arguments
:: GLuint |
|
-> GLenum |
|
-> Ptr GLfloat |
|
-> IO () |
Manual pages for OpenGL 3.x or OpenGL 4.x
Arguments
:: GLuint |
|
-> GLenum |
|
-> Ptr GLint |
|
-> IO () |
Manual pages for OpenGL 3.x or OpenGL 4.x
Arguments
:: GLuint |
|
-> GLenum |
|
-> Ptr GLuint |
|
-> IO () |
Manual pages for OpenGL 3.x or OpenGL 4.x
glGetSamplerParameteriv Source
Arguments
:: GLuint |
|
-> GLenum |
|
-> Ptr GLint |
|
-> IO () |
Manual pages for OpenGL 3.x or OpenGL 4.x
glGetSamplerParameterIiv Source
Arguments
:: GLuint |
|
-> GLenum |
|
-> Ptr GLint |
|
-> IO () |
Manual pages for OpenGL 3.x or OpenGL 4.x
glGetSamplerParameterfv Source
Arguments
:: GLuint |
|
-> GLenum |
|
-> Ptr GLfloat |
|
-> IO () |
Manual pages for OpenGL 3.x or OpenGL 4.x
glGetSamplerParameterIuiv Source
Arguments
:: GLuint |
|
-> GLenum |
|
-> Ptr GLuint |
|
-> IO () |
Manual pages for OpenGL 3.x or OpenGL 4.x